Find the distance between the points (3,4) and (5,9). Leave in simplest radical form.

Respuesta :

mhanifa
mhanifa mhanifa
  • 20-08-2020

Answer:

√29

Step-by-step explanation:

  • The distance between points (x1, y1) and (x2, y2) is:
  • d = √(x2-x1)² + (y2-y1)²

We have points (3,4) and (5,9), so the distance:

  • d = √(5-3)² + (9-4)² = √4 + 25 = √29
